CourseDetails

โ€ข Media Ownership Structures: An in-depth examination of various media ownership structures, their impact on the creative industries, and the role of government regulation.
โ€ข Global Media Trends: Analysis of current global media trends, focusing on the creative industries, and their implications for media ownership.
โ€ข Digital Platforms and Media Ownership: Investigating the relationship between digital platforms and media ownership, including the impact of social media, search engines, and over-the-top (OTT) services on the creative industries.
โ€ข Media Concentration and Diversity: Examining the effects of media concentration on diversity in the creative industries and strategies to foster greater diversity in media ownership.
โ€ข Financing and Investment in Media: Exploring various financing and investment models for media ownership, including venture capital, private equity, and crowdfunding, and their impact on the creative industries.
โ€ข Media Ownership and Creative Freedom: Investigating the relationship between media ownership and creative freedom, including the role of independent media in promoting diverse and innovative creative content.
โ€ข Media Ownership and Cultural Identity: Examining the impact of media ownership on cultural identity, diversity, and representation in the creative industries.
โ€ข Media Ownership and Regulation: Analysis of media ownership regulation and its role in shaping the creative industries, including comparative studies of media regulation in different countries.
โ€ข Ethical Considerations in Media Ownership: Investigating the ethical considerations surrounding media ownership and its impact on the creative industries, including issues related to transparency, accountability, and social responsibility.
โ€ข Future of Media Ownership in Creative Industries: Speculating on the future of media ownership and its potential impact on the creative industries, including emerging trends and technologies.
